Faqs:
What are the primary applications of aluminum honeycomb panels in solar energy systems?
Aluminum honeycomb panels are used as structural backing for solar panels, providing lightweight durability, enhanced stiffness, and thermal management to improve efficiency and longevity in harsh conditions.
How do aluminum honeycomb panels contribute to thermal management in solar panels?
The high thermal conductivity of aluminum helps dissipate heat from solar cells, preventing overheating and improving efficiency. Some designs include ventilation within the honeycomb structure for better thermal regulation.
What customization options are available for aluminum honeycomb panels?
Panels can be customized in thickness (5mm-50mm), width (1220mm, 1500mm, or other), length (2440mm or other), surface finish (PE/PVDF/anodic oxidation), and color (white, silver, wooden grain, etc.).
